A stacked sub on Italian bread with cured meats, cheese, lettuce, tomato, onion, oil, and vinegar. Hoboken is especially known for old-school Italian delis and giant sandwiches.
House-made mozzarella, often served with roasted peppers, tomatoes, or on sandwiches. Hoboken's Italian heritage makes fresh mozzarella a signature local staple.
A New Jersey style pizza with a thin crust and bright tomato sauce, sometimes with the sauce layered prominently over the cheese. It reflects the region's Italian-American pizza tradition.

Costs are high by U.S. standards, especially for dining and hotels, due to proximity to Manhattan.
Tip 18-20% at restaurants; 20%+ for great service. USD 1-2 per drink at bars, round up taxis, and tip delivery about 15-20%.
